Initialize Unit Operation Parameter (Service Code: 3D hex)
Initializes the Unit operation settings (NX object) of the specified NX Unit.
The initialized parameters are valid after the NX Unit is restarted.
By executing this service, NX Unit Memory All Cleared (95810000 hex) is registered in the event log.
When the NX Unit is Operational or Safe-Operational, you need to initialize the status beforehand with
the Switch parameter write mode service. If the Initialize unit operation parameter is executed without
carrying out this step, error will result, and Device state conflict (10 hex) will be returned to the General
Status.
This service does not support the NX-series Safety Control Unit. If this service is executed for the
NXseries Safety Control Unit, an error will occur.
